The Columbia Fireflies open their season a lot more sluggingly than the Mets, pounding out a 14-7 win over the Augusta Greenjackets. The onslaught begain in the second as new leftfielder Tim Tebow made his regular season debut as professional baseballer by hitting a two-run homer in his first at-bat.

He went 0-4 with three strikeouts after that, but the journey began the right way.

A rained-out doubleheader between the Fireflies and the fearsome DelMarVa Shorebirds has put the South Atlantic League schedule-maker behind the eight-ball. Who wants to take another bus ride from Columbia, South Carolina to the Salisbury, Maryland? After two days of rainouts, you know they were bored. I should have driven out and hung out with my boy Merandy and asked him to introduce me to Tebow.

Merandy (5-1, 1.88) is still joining with the unadopted Jordan Humphreys (6-0, 1.63) as the most devastating 1-2 punch in affiliated baseball. Between the two of them, they have thrown 77 innings, striking out 84 and walking 12. Beware.

Making a nice debut out of the bullpen is the newly promoted Jake Simon, who threw three innings of one-hit, scoreless ball against Lakewood earlier in the week. Look for more from him.

The offensive leader has been secondbaseman Michael Paez, who has put up a .262 / .344 / .495 // .839 line so far. He's 10th in the league in RBI and it's always nice to see offense coming from your middle infield. Catcher Anthony Dimino was 7-10 before going down with another injury.

This Jordan Humphries kid at Columbia is getting it done: 6-1, 1.77 in 7 starts so far, 57 whiffs and 6 walks in 45.2 innings.

Baseball America a few weeks back called him "someone to watch" throws 92-94 "with late life." 18th round draft pick out of high school in Florida a few years ago.



Between him, Merandy Gonzelez (5-1, 1.59) and Gabe Llanes (2-2, 2.40) they have a nice starting ro in Columbia.
